Associations to the word «Seminal»

Wiktionary

SEMINAL, adjective. Of or relating to seed or semen.
SEMINAL, adjective. Creative or having the power to originate.
SEMINAL, adjective. Highly influential, especially in some original way, and providing a basis for future development or research.
SEMINAL, noun. (obsolete) A seed.
SEMINAL FLUID, noun. Semen
SEMINAL VESICLE, noun. (anatomy) One of two simple tubular glands located behind the male urinary bladder, responsible for the production of about sixty percent of the fluid that ultimately becomes semen.
SEMINAL VESICLES, noun. Plural of seminal vesicle

Dictionary definition

SEMINAL, adjective. Pertaining to or containing or consisting of semen; "seminal fluid".
SEMINAL, adjective. Containing seeds of later development; "seminal ideas of one discipline can influence the growth of another".
